    The New England Patriots have signed Pro Bowl linebacker Jerod Mayo to a five-year contract extension, a league source told ESPN NFL Insider Adam Schefter on Saturday.Mayo, despite missing two games in October with a sprained knee, ranks third for the Patriots with 68 tackles this season after a year in which he logged a career-best 175 and was voted to his first Pro Bowl. He was the AP's defensive rookie of the year in 2008. News of the signing comes six days after Mayo pulled in his second interception in as many weeks in a win over the Washington Redskins. His previous interception, in a win over the Indianapolis Colts, had been the first of his four-year career.
